Ford Transit Connect X-Press & Renault Sport Megane Driven by Tiff Needell race against the clock. What would result from the unlikely "marriage" of a low-roof, highly practical Ford Transit Connect van with the power unit and brakes from Ford's high-performance, top-of-the-range, Focus RS? The answer is the 'vantastic' Transit Connect X-Press - the fastest and most dramatic version of Ford's tough and highly versatile small commercial to hit the tarmac. Lower (by up to 70 mm), meaner (with 18-inch OZ alloys) and emitting an exhaust note more akin to that of Ford's Focus RS in World Rally Championship trim, X-Press is an undeniably special Transit Connect. Even if you fail to spot the integral, "race-spec" roll cage fitted inside this one-off vehicle, it would be almost impossible to ignore the pearlescent white paint job set off with tri-colour X-Press graphics.
